What to Bring to an ARRL Exam Session: 1. MANDATORY BEFORE THE EXAM FCC Registration Number (FRN): Examinees are required by the FCC to submit your FRN with your license application form. New license applicants must create an FCC user account and register their Social Security Number (SSN) in the FCC Commission Registration System (CORES) before attending exam sessions. Registrants will be assigned an FRN which will be used in all license transactions with the FCC. For instructions on how to register your SSN and receive an FRN from the FCC, visit the CORES Registration page and the FCC's Registration instructions page. Per FCC rules, a valid email address is also mandatory on the application form to receive FCC correspondence, including the official copy of your Amateur Radio license.

  2.  One legal photo ID (identification):
       a. State Driver’s License
       b. Government issued Passport
       c. Military or Law Enforcement Officer Photo ID card
       d. Student School Photo ID card
       e. State Photo ID card

  3.  If no photo ID is available, two forms of identification:
       a. Non-photo State ID card (some states still have them)
       b. Birth certificate (must have the appropriate seal)
       c. Social security card
       d. Employer's wage statement or Minor's work permit
       e. School ID card
       f. School or Public Library card
       g. Utility bill, bank statement or other business correspondence that
           specifically names the person; or a postmarked envelope addressed
           to the person at his or her current mailing address as it appears on
           the Form 605.

  4.  Students/minors without a photo ID need to bring only one of the
       above items if a legal guardian presents their photo ID; otherwise 
       two non-photo IDs are required. ARRL will cover the one-time FCC
       application fee for new license candidates younger than 18-years
       old for tests administered under the ARRL VEC program.
       Candidates younger than 18-years old would pay a reduced exam
       session fee of $5 to the ARRL VEC VE team at the time of the exam.
       Visit the Youth Licensing Grant Program webpage for more
       information and for the reimbursement instructions.
       Minor children (under the age of 18) may be accompanied in the 
       room by an adult during the test.

  5.  If applicable, bring a printed copy of your Amateur Radio license
       or be able to show proof of the license in the official FCC database.
       Acceptable copies or printouts of licenses are available from the
       following sources: the official license or reference license printed
       from the FCC website or license data printed from the ARRL website
       or QRZ website. The original(s) and photocopy(s) of any Certificates
       of Successful Completion of Examination (CSCE) you may hold from
       previous exam sessions. If your license has already been issued by
       the FCC, the CSCE showing license credit is not needed. The
       candidate is require to show proof of the current license to the team 
       but the team is no longer required to submit the proof to the VEC.
       Expired license proof must be submitted to the team and to the
       VEC for processing to FCC. These photocopies will not be returned.
       Instructions on how to obtain an official FCC license copy are on
       our Obtain License Copy web page.
